While there is no record of Hitler praising Allah directly, he frequently praised Islam as a martial and "manly" religion, stating it was better suited to the "Germanic temperament" than Christianity. Hitler believed Islam offered a superior, militaristic ideology that suited his political needs, contrasting it with what he saw as the weak "meekness" of Christianity.
Key Aspects of Hitler's Views on Islam
Admiration for Martial Qualities: Hitler reportedly admired Islam's focus on strength, paradise, and combat, stating that if the Saracens had not been stopped at the Battle of Tours, Islam would have been a better faith for Europe than "Jewish Christianity".
Contempt for Christianity: Albert Speer reported that Hitler saw Christianity as a "decadent" religion of "meekness and flabbiness".
Political Pragmatism: Hitler viewed religion merely as a tool to support the state. His admiration was based on a shared distaste for Jews and Soviet Russia rather than spiritual belief.
